2. Not Setting a Realistic Budget

Wedding budgets are one of the most important foundations for your planning process, yet they’re often overlooked or underestimated.

It’s easy to get carried away with Pinterest-worthy ideas or over-the-top trends. Without a clear and realistic budget, you might find yourself overwhelmed by unexpected costs down the line.

Start by having an honest conversation with your partner and any family members who may be contributing financially. Be sure to consider hidden costs like taxes, gratuities, and alterations, as these can add up quickly.

Create a spreadsheet to track expenses and ensure you’re staying within your limits throughout the planning process. Prioritize the elements that matter most, and don’t forget to include wiggle room for unforeseen expenses.

4. Skipping the Guest List Conversation

The guest list is a source of stress for many couples, and it’s easy to see why. Deciding who to invite can be tricky, especially when balancing family dynamics, budgets, and venue capacity.

Skipping this conversation early on can lead to misunderstandings and unnecessary tension.

Before sending out save-the-dates, sit down with your partner and draft a preliminary guest list. Take into account how your guest count will affect the atmosphere, catering, and overall experience.

Think about including a mix of close family, lifelong friends, and people who have been part of your journey as a couple.

Consider what feels right for your celebration, whether that’s an intimate gathering or a grand affair. With thoughtful planning, you can create a guest list that perfectly reflects your vision for the day.

5. Ignoring the Importance of a Wedding Planner or Coordinator

Some couples assume they can handle every detail themselves, but the reality of wedding planning can quickly become overwhelming. Without the help of a wedding planner or coordinator, it’s easy to overlook small but critical details.

A dedicated venue coordinator specializes in making your big day seamless. They can assist with creating a detailed timeline to keep the day on track, coordinating with vendors to ensure everyone is aligned, and handling any unexpected hiccups that arise.

Additionally, they can provide guidance on setup, oversee transitions between events like the ceremony and reception, and help manage guest flow for a stress-free experience.

Whether you need help with timelines, vendor coordination, or last-minute adjustments, they are there to ensure everything runs smoothly.

7. Overloading the To-Do List Early

The excitement of wedding planning can lead some couples to take on too much at once. While it’s important to stay organized, overloading your to-do list early on can lead to burnout and frustration.

Instead, break tasks into manageable phases. Focus on major decisions first, like setting your date, securing your venue, and choosing key vendors. Once those are in place, you can move on to smaller details like décor, attire, and guest favors without feeling overwhelmed.

By pacing yourself and staying organized, you’ll enjoy the planning process rather than feeling buried by it.

9. Not Communicating with Vendors

Strong communication with your vendors is essential for a smooth wedding day. Failing to share your vision, ask questions, or confirm details can lead to confusion and disappointment.

One of the most commonly overlooked aspects is confirming logistical details like arrival times, setup requirements, and equipment needs. Another detail often forgotten is a final walkthrough of the venue to ensure everything is set up as envisioned.
